Whamcloud - gitweb
git://git.whamcloud.com
/
fs
/
lustre-release.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
LU-241 Support crc32c with hardware accelerated instruction as one of lustre checksums
[fs/lustre-release.git]
/
lustre
/
liblustre
/
llite_cl.c
diff --git
a/lustre/liblustre/llite_cl.c
b/lustre/liblustre/llite_cl.c
index
4d6e8b1
..
ed8c988
100644
(file)
--- a/
lustre/liblustre/llite_cl.c
+++ b/
lustre/liblustre/llite_cl.c
@@
-36,16
+36,6
@@
# include <sys/statfs.h>
#endif
# include <sys/statfs.h>
#endif
-#include <sysio.h>
-#ifdef HAVE_XTIO_H
-#include <xtio.h>
-#endif
-#include <fs.h>
-#include <mount.h>
-#include <inode.h>
-#ifdef HAVE_FILE_H
-#include <file.h>
-#endif
#include <liblustre.h>
#include <obd.h>
#include <liblustre.h>
#include <obd.h>
@@
-451,14
+441,14
@@
static int slp_io_rw_lock(const struct lu_env *env,
}
}
-static int slp_io_
trunc
_iter_init(const struct lu_env *env,
- const struct cl_io_slice *ios)
+static int slp_io_
setattr
_iter_init(const struct lu_env *env,
+
const struct cl_io_slice *ios)
{
return 0;
}
{
return 0;
}
-static int slp_io_
trunc
_start(const struct lu_env *env,
- const struct cl_io_slice *ios)
+static int slp_io_
setattr
_start(const struct lu_env *env,
+
const struct cl_io_slice *ios)
{
return 0;
}
{
return 0;
}
@@
-661,7
+651,7
@@
static int slp_io_start(const struct lu_env *env, const struct cl_io_slice *ios)
GOTO(out, err);
CDEBUG(D_INODE,
GOTO(out, err);
CDEBUG(D_INODE,
- "%s ino %lu, %lu bytes, offset
%lld, i_size %llu
\n",
+ "%s ino %lu, %lu bytes, offset
"LPU64", i_size "LPU64"
\n",
write ? "Write" : "Read", (unsigned long)st->st_ino,
cnt, (__u64)pos, (__u64)st->st_size);
write ? "Write" : "Read", (unsigned long)st->st_ino,
cnt, (__u64)pos, (__u64)st->st_size);
@@
-739,10
+729,10
@@
static const struct cl_io_operations ccc_io_ops = {
.cio_end = ccc_io_end,
.cio_advance = ccc_io_advance
},
.cio_end = ccc_io_end,
.cio_advance = ccc_io_advance
},
- [CIT_
TRUNC
] = {
+ [CIT_
SETATTR
] = {
.cio_fini = ccc_io_fini,
.cio_fini = ccc_io_fini,
- .cio_iter_init = slp_io_
trunc
_iter_init,
- .cio_start = slp_io_
trunc
_start
+ .cio_iter_init = slp_io_
setattr
_iter_init,
+ .cio_start = slp_io_
setattr
_start
},
[CIT_MISC] = {
.cio_fini = ccc_io_fini
},
[CIT_MISC] = {
.cio_fini = ccc_io_fini